What eSignature and digital signature mean

An eSignature is an electronic mark, symbol, or process used to show intent to sign a record, while a digital signature uses cryptography to protect identity and document integrity. In practice, both support paperless signing for U.S. businesses, but they work differently. signNow captures the signer’s action, records the event, and stores the document history. A digital signature adds certificate-based verification, hashing, and tamper evidence so changes after signing are detectable.

Why eSignature and digital signature matter

They reduce paper handling, speed approvals, and create records that can be enforced under ESIGN and UETA when consent, intent, and attribution are documented. For U.S. businesses, that means faster turnaround with legally defensible workflows and clearer evidence if a signed record is later disputed.

Why teams look for DocuSign alternatives

Common eSignature pain points

  • Signer consent is missing, so the record may not satisfy ESIGN notice and consent requirements.
  • Weak authentication makes it harder to attribute the signature to the right person.
  • Incomplete audit trails leave gaps in timestamps, IP data, or signing actions.
  • Retention rules are unclear, which can create problems in HIPAA, FERPA, or litigation holds.

Best practices for reliable signing

A few setup choices can improve attribution, record quality, and long-term usability without adding unnecessary complexity.

Route by role

Use role-based routing so each signer receives only the documents they need, in the right order. This reduces confusion, limits unnecessary access, and makes the signing path easier to review later.

Capture consent early

Collect signer consent before sending records electronically, and keep the consent record with the signed file. That helps support ESIGN and UETA enforceability when the transaction later needs to be reviewed.

Match authentication to risk

Require stronger authentication for higher-risk documents, such as SMS OTP or ID verification. Match the method to the transaction value, the sensitivity of the record, and your internal policy.

Align retention and access

Keep retention and access rules aligned with HIPAA, FERPA, or internal record policies. Store completed documents, audit trails, and related approvals together so the record stays usable over time.

What the audit trail records

The audit trail shows how the record was authenticated, sealed, and preserved after signing.

01

Signer authentication:

Verifies the signer before the record is accepted.
02

Timestamp capture:

Records UTC time for each signing event.
03

Document hashing:

Creates a hash for the signed document.
04

Tamper-evident sealing:

Seals the file so later edits are detectable.
05

Audit trail storage:

Stores the event history with the completed file.
06

Retrieval and export:

Exports the record for review or litigation.
